Cox Plate champion James McDonald has shown his class with a touching gesture after claiming victory at Moonee Valley on Saturday .

Just hours after saluting aboard Via Sistina, the superstar jockey dusted himself off and took his trophy for a special visit to see injured apprentice Tom Prebble.

Prebble, the 23-year-old son of Melbourne Cup-winning jockey Brett, is in rehab after a devastating fall that has left him with no feeling below his T4 vertebrae .

The racing fraternity continues to rally around Prebble, whose mother is Maree of the famous Payne family.
